Commuters in an open train door at Churchgate Station, a terminus of Western Railway line of Mumbai Suburban Railway in India. The sign next to the train door states that the coach seen here is a ladies-only car at certain times of the day; Mumbai Suburban Railway carries 6.94 million passengers per day.
